9th Episode of Phone Live-in Grievance program receives overwhelming public response; More than 40 calls received

RAJOURI, November 03: In a resounding testament to community engagement, the 9th episode of the Phone Live-in Grievances program in Rajouri witnessed an extraordinary outpouring of public response, with more than 40 calls flooding in from residents across the district.

This innovative initiative, designed to provide an immediate platform for district residents to voice their concerns and obtain swift solutions from the district administration, drew enthusiastic participation from individuals across the district.

Led by the Deputy Commissioner Vikas Kundal, callers were given the full opportunity to voice their concerns on a wide spectrum of issues. Deputy Commissioner Vikas Kundal exhibited remarkable patience and unwavering commitment in addressing each caller’s concerns, providing invaluable guidance and support to resolve their problems.

In direct response to the concerns of the residents, Deputy Commissioner Vikas Kundal assured them that prompt and effective measures would be taken to address their issues within specified timeframes. He further encouraged residents to continue providing feedback and suggestions, underscoring the constructive role these inputs play in enhancing governance and development in the district.
